Samaritan Zatoichi is a gritty slice of the Zatoichi saga, melding action and drama in a way that feels both raw and layered. The atmosphere is heavy, underscored by the looming presence of the yakuza, and the pacing strikes a balance between tension and the quiet moments that define Zatoichi's character. The narrative dives deep into themes of honor, sacrifice, and the moral complexities of debt. Practical effects are used to depict the visceral violence of the times without overshadowing the emotional weight of the story. The performances, particularly from the leads, carry a certain weight that makes their fates resonate, leaving you with a sense of lingering unease and reflection.
Samaritan Zatoichi has had a modest presence in collector circles, with various VHS and DVD releases, but original prints are quite scarce. Many collectors appreciate the film for its unique take within the Zatoichi franchise, often overshadowed by more known titles. Interest in this film has grown, especially among those looking to complete their Zatoichi collections, but finding good quality prints can be challenging.
